You’ll be part of a skilled team maintaining and repairing refrigeration systems, equipment, and facility infrastructure.If you enjoy solving problems, working with your hands, and building your expertise in ammonia refrigeration, this could be a great fit for you.What You’ll Do
Perform preventative and predictive maintenance on ammonia, Freon, and/or CO2 refrigeration systems, electrical systems, machinery, and building infrastructure.
Troubleshoot, repair, and maintain equipment to keep operations safe and efficient.
Complete work orders and document maintenance activities in our CMMS system.
Support inspections, testing, and compliance with safety standards and regulations.
Collaborate with leadership and team members to share updates and solutions.
Occasionally oversee contractors working near refrigeration systems to ensure safety and compliance.
What We’re Looking For✅ 2+ years of industrial refrigeration experience required (ammonia, Freon, and/or CO2).
✅ Refrigeration Operator I and/or CIRO certification highly preferred.
✅ 3+ years mechanical experience with motorized lifts, warehouse, processing, or manufacturing equipment (or equivalent trade school training).
✅ MHE/Forklift electrical maintenance experience preferred.
✅ Knowledge of basic electrical, pneumatic, hydraulic, and instrumentation systems.
✅ Strong problem-solving skills and ability to communicate technical details to a non-technical audience.
✅ Comfortable working in cold storage (-20°F) or dry storage (up to 100°F) environments.
✅ Ability to lift 40+ lbs and work flexible schedules, including weekends if needed.
